Arla Foods Ingredients has been granted its first non-GMO project certification
Native milk protein MicelPure has become the first Arla Foods Ingredients product certified by the Non-GMO Project.

This certification assures consumers of compliance with the Non-GMO Project Standard, which involves strict testing, traceability and segregation provisions. MicelPure is a micellar casein isolate, and it is ideal for sports nutrition and other healthy food applications, because it contains 86% native protein and it is naturally high in calcium. //
